The stories of Shane, one of my favourite fighters, getting beaten up by prospects in sparring were disturbing. That was pre-Mayweather. He looked decent for five minutes against Mayweather - a cagey opening round and two big right hands. But look at round two closely - he was huffing and puffing as he dealt out damage, he struggled to put a series of shots together, he didn't step out to punching range when Floyd was trying to grab on, and he had nothing left after that. The right hands in round two aside, he looked **** and it wasn't really down to Mayweather's defensive brilliance. He was just totally faded, as we saw in the Mora fight where he couldn't put any offence together. He still has fast hands and big power, but his reflexes are shot to ****. He can't pull the trigger, so all we'd get is a tapping fest where Khan keeps outside of danger and Mosley lumbers around like the 40-year old he nearly is.
